Novae increases 2013 final dividend by 13.8% and pays 20p special
  • Excellent underwriting contribution of £48.9 million, an increase of 50% (2012: £32.6 million)

  • Gross written premium of £590.3 million (2012: £612.0 million), including:
    - planned reductions in reinsurance for the first half of the year
    - growth of 6% in the second half of the year

  • Combined ratio of 86 % (2012: 90 %)

  • Net investment income of £11.1 million (2012: £25.8 million), equating to 0.9% on average invested assets (2012: 2.2%)

  • Profit before tax of £42.8 million (2012: £39.9 million)

  • Basic earnings per share increased to 50.2p (2012: 44.2p)

  • Final dividend of 16.5p per share (2012: 14.5p per share)

  • Additional special dividend of 20.0p per share

Matthew Fosh, Group Chief Executive, today said:

"I am delighted with our result for 2013, which for the third time in four years has produced a record underwriting performance and is testament to the discipline and judgement of our team. Maintaining this consistency of performance from a combination of specialist underwriting and sound capital management is central to our strategy."
